Food Drive a Smash Success!

The Mothers Day Food Drive concluded yesterday in a big way! Over fifty bags stuffed with groceries were brought in to the church; monetary donations were also placed in the offertory. The food and money collected will go to the FOCUS Food Pantry to be distributed to area families in need. Thank you to all who donated in honor of their mothers!

prayA Place to Pray

The Prayer Team Ministry has been praying at the back of the church with individuals during communion for several months now. Space at the back of the church is tight and the Vestry is considering proposals to create a space where prayer can take place undisturbed. One proposal is to remove several of the short pews at the rear right side of the church. Comments are requested (two have been made so far). The matter will be discussed at the May 17 Vestry meeting.
